      the center storm flap is only secured down by three velcro points and it is already too slim and thin so when it was windy I had a cold spot down the center zipper. also the lack of outer pockets and stiff tiny pocket zips did not make for an easy cold weather coat (wearing gloves and operating the zips). it is a great looking, light wieght coat that is warm with it's 800 fill double V baffle construction but the box wall baffle Montane Deep Cold Down Jacket is just as light and warmer with way better storm flaps and pockets.

      Hey Roy! This is so true! I actually did a photo analysis comparing the various baffle styles on my Montane Deep Cold Down Jacket review! The warmest is the BOX wall baffle while the least warmest is the STITCH-THRU or V-Style baffle.
